Ciao a tutti, avete presente la progress bar che compare sulla status bar di Internet Explorer quando si esegue il download in una pagina? Conoscete il modo per realizzarla con VB6?
Grazie
Ciao a tutti, avete presente la progress bar che compare sulla status bar di Internet Explorer quando si esegue il download in una pagina? Conoscete il modo per realizzarla con VB6?
Grazie
ma in che contesto la usi?
Ho un form MDI e spesso le finestre che opro devono fare delle elaborazioni. Sarebbe più carino a livello estetico, pensavo, invece di mettere in ogni finestra un controllo ProgressBar utilizzarne uno unico sulla StutusBar del form MDI.
Grazie
Dai un'occhiata qui:
http://vbnet.mvps.org/index.html?co...arinstatbar.htm
e qui:
http://vbnet.mvps.org/index.html?co...atbarsimple.htm
Credo siano ciò che volevi...
The Fresh...remaker
A volte la risposta è sotto ai nostri occhi, bisogna solo aver voglia di cercarla!!
http://www.angelsinthedark.it
su entrambi i link mi da: The page cannot be found
ci si può riuscire, con un piccolo trucco
la StatusBar, non fa da contenitore, per cui è necessario che a far da contenitore per la ProgressBar sia una PictureBox, allineata in Basso, sull'MDI, e che conterrà sia la StatusBar che la ProgressBar.
per fare una prova quindi, apri un nuovo progetto, aggiungici un MDI e metti una PictureBox (Picture1) nel Form, allineata in basso, e dentro di essa una StatusBar, con qualche Panel già inserito, e una ProgressBar... non importa la loro posizione.
poi usa questo codice:
ovviamente la visualizzazione della ProgressBar, non va fatta per forza nell'evento Resize del Form, puoi farla vedere a tua discrezione, quando ti serve e in concomitanza dell'evento che vuoi.codice:Private Sub MDIForm_Resize() Picture1.BorderStyle = 0 Picture1.Height = StatusBar1.Height StatusBar1.Move 0, 0, Picture1.ScaleWidth, StatusBar1.Height ProgressBar1.Move StatusBar1.Panels(1).Left, StatusBar1.Top + 30, StatusBar1.Panels(1).Width, StatusBar1.Height ProgressBar1.ZOrder (0) ProgressBar1.Value = ProgressBar1.Max End Sub
Boolean
Si devono essere incriccati i link nel copiaggio![]()
1) http://vbnet.mvps.org/code/comctl/progbarinstatbar.htm
2) http://vbnet.mvps.org/code/comctl/statbarsimple.htm
Spero così vadano...Cmq ho visto che Boolean è già stato più che esauriente!![]()
The Fresh...remaker
A volte la risposta è sotto ai nostri occhi, bisogna solo aver voglia di cercarla!!
http://www.angelsinthedark.it